Frequently driving your car with little fuel can harm your engine over time because the gasoline at the bottom of your tank is usually the dirtiest. When this part is used for fuel, you run a higher risk of dirt reaching your fuel line and engine.

What Are the Signs That I Need a Timing Belt Replacement?
Signs indicating the need for a timing belt replacement include ticking engine noises, trouble starting, or reduced engine power. Is Head Gasket Replacement Essential, and When Should It Be Done?
The head gasket is crucial for sealing engine fluids, and failure can lead to overheating and damage. Initial signs include white exhaust smoke or coolant loss. Why is my "Check Engine" light flashing?
A flashing light usually indicates a severe engine misfire that could damage your catalytic converter. This requires immediate engine diagnostics to identify the fault. Q. "Why is my engine overheating?"The 3 most common reasons your engine is overheating are you have a cooling system leak, a malfunctioning radiator, or a loose/broken belt.
